What oil does the handbook say it needs?

Should have thought of that, i keep forgetting the car comes with a manual lol

It lists 2 types as the Manual is for all Toyota Yaris'

1KR-FE Engines & 2ZR-FE Engines.

Turns out 1 KR-FE is the 1.0L ones so thats out

http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Toyota_KR_engine

leaving the 2ZR-FE

http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Toyota_ZR_engine

Looks right, which it says:-

SAE 0W-20 is the best choice, if SAW 0W-20 is not available then 5W-30 may be used until the next oil change.
